Abstract

The utility model discloses an oil pressure switch detection device. The oil pressure switch detection device comprises a direct-current circuit, a conduction indicating lamp, an oil pressure switch connection device, a low pressure test device, a high pressure test device, a one-way exhaust valve, an oil supply pipeline and an oil supply device. The conduction indicating lamp and the oil pressure switch connection device are arranged in the direct-current circuit. The low pressure test device and the high pressure test device are serially connected and arranged in the oil supply pipeline and serially connected with the oil pressure switch connection device. The oil supply pipeline is connected with the oil supply device. The one-way exhaust valve is connected with the oil supply pipeline. The oil pressure switch detection device has advantages of accurate measurement and high working efficiency, and can be used to complete the pressure resistance and pathway disconnection pressure performance detection simultaneously.

Background technology
Because path opening pressure and sealing load (resistance to pressure) difference of oil-pressure shut-off switch are larger, use conventional sense method, the sealing of encapsulation place that can only test oil compresses switch.The path opening pressure of conventional oil-pressure shut-off switch can only detect operation on engine, time-consuming, the work efficiency of requiring great effort is not only low and easily judge by accident.
Chinese patent literature (open day: on July 20th, 2011, publication number: CN201903427U) disclose a kind of proving installation for mechanical oil pressure switch, comprise oil pump, the oil-in conducting of oil pump is connected with fuel tank, the oil-out of oil pump is connected with mechanical pressure gauge and/or digital pressure gauge by connecting line, on described connecting line, is connected with described mechanical pressure gauge and/or digital pressure gauge conducting in parallel the fuel feed pump being connected for the oil supply hole conducting with mechanical oil pressure switch.
Technique scheme solves the not high problem of mechanical oil pressure switch testing efficiency that is, and technique scheme also can only complete the resistance to pressure detection of mechanical oil pressure switch.

Oil-pressure shut-off switch principle of work;
Due to oil-pressure shut-off switch, comprise that the structures such as oil-in, diaphragm, push rod, moving contact, stationary contact, Compress Spring, lower gate terminal form, when engine oil pressure enters oil-pressure shut-off switch contact, act on diaphragm, push rod, if overcome the elastic force of Compress Spring when engine oil pressure reaches standard, will make moving contact separated with stationary contact, thereby realize the disconnection between oil-pressure shut-off switch circuit.Otherwise when engine oil pressure does not reach standard, moving contact is separated with stationary contact, make to disconnect to reach between circuit the effect of warning, moreover when engine oil pressure reaches standard, moving contact and stationary contact divide to be unable to do without and also can reach the effect of warning.According to the principle of work of oil-pressure shut-off switch, this oil-pressure shut-off switch pick-up unit, by oil-pressure shut-off switch coupling arrangement is set in a DC circuit, oil-pressure shut-off switch to be tested is connected to oil-pressure shut-off switch coupling arrangement, turn on the power switch, connected DC circuit, oil-pressure shut-off switch, DC circuit form loop, conducting pilot lamp lights, opening the gas by oil feed line inside of one-way exhaust valve discharges, open the high and low pressure throttling valve in oil feed line, start oil pump, test oil compresses switch breaks, opens pressure.Conducting pilot lamp can occur normal bright or not work according to oil-pressure shut-off switch conducting situation (separating action of inner moving contact), and low pressure throttling valve can show the measured value of oil-pressure shut-off switch simultaneously.Close low pressure throttling valve, oil pump continues measured piece oil-pressure shut-off switch to be forced into required withstand voltage standard value, the sealing of visual examination measured piece, the resistance to pressure that test oil compresses switch.Being completed the rear high pressure throttling valve of first opening opens low pressure throttling valve (protection low voltage experiment indicator impaired) again the oil in oil feed line is flow back in oil groove.This oil-pressure shut-off switch pick-up unit, measures accurately, and work efficiency is high, and the pressure of breaking, open that can simultaneously complete resistance to pressure, path detects.
